Background Information
The pace of change in internet marketing and advertising leaves many
other areas of business management at the starting gates. While many marketers
are well into their first or multiple generations of various applications
of internet marketing and advertising, the real questions that seems to
be left on the board room table is where are these applications going and
what will be the landscape of internet assisted/integrated/dominated business
practice five to ten years from today. What is going on now in terms of
breakthrough academic and/or practitioner conceptual frameworks/research/practice
that is likely to play a dominant role in determining business performance
in the future?
